// Restock planner client for the Snackline fleet.
// Pulls inventory deltas from Cartfill every 15 min,
// solves the route plan, pushes picks to the depot queue.
// Known quirk: machines offline >24h get skipped — by
// design, don't "fix" it. Flagging for the weekly sync.
// Client auths against Cartfill with the key below.

API key for kajog-tajep: zpat11_KM2XGfcA8zM

**14:22 — Rounding divergence confirmed.** The Coinlathe conversion service was truncating half-cent remainders instead of applying banker's rounding, so bulk settlement totals drifted by up to a few cents per thousand transactions. Future maintainers: the fix lives in the remainder-allocation routine, and any change there must rerun the golden-ledger suite before merge. We pinned the deploy that introduced the regression for audit purposes; its trace token appears immediately below.

session token of tagef-hahag = htk4_f22a

Quarterly Planning Note — Divestment of Harwick Analytics Unit

For the Board: the sale of the Harwick Analytics unit to Pellastone Group remains on track for completion next quarter. Due diligence closed with two minor findings, both resolved. Proceeds are projected at the upper end of the range modelled in March. Transition services will run for nine months, staffed from the Colgrave office. Employee consultations begin next week. Intended use of proceeds and subsequent portfolio moves are set out in the confidential note below.

board note of fahif-yahog: Gross margin on Wenath came in at 10 percent against a plan of 5 percent. Only 3 of the 100 pilot accounts renewed Wenath, so a churn review is set for July 15.